In my humble opinion, there is no 'rebel endgame' to be had. At least nothing that doesn't fuck over the rest of the server. This was an issue Gutsy raised last year (and I had incorrectly ignored it) and I can see it now.

This is mainly because the only sensible "endgame" for rebels is allowing an Uprising, imo.

But making one ends in a full server reset, which means Willard has to bank on the reset being promising enough to draw people back while also solving the issues with the current system. If it isn't? Willard has just shot its cash cow in the head.

I can think of a few reasons for why things have turned out the way they have:

1) People have become used to constant events/expos which are generally safer and higher quality instead of making RP on the main server - and when they do want to do something "rebel-like" on the main server? You get the current events.

2) The server lore is massively inconsistent and constantly heating up all over. Its so much of a mess that people have given up trying for almost any context of whats happening and so tend to be bolder when they wanna go big.

3) Guns and gear are a thousand times easier to get than they used to be, meaning you can basically skip doing anything City related entirely and be armed for war in about a week. What then? You want to use your cool gun to fight, which leads you back to 1.

In my humble opinion, there is no 'rebel endgame' to be had. At least nothing that doesn't fuck over the rest of the server. This was an issue Gutsy raised last year (and I had incorrectly ignored it) and I can see it now.

So, again in my opinion, there are a few ways forward from here. Here they are and some thoughts about them.

1) Accept the lower quality server RP from now on.
This is an option. It is the one we are taking right now, and no one is happy about it.

2) Remove the gear from the rebels.
Of course, the economy reset Dev is talking about is the rebel economy (just to clear any confusion). This is also an option, and one we had done in Terminal 7. In my opinion, it's a bandaid. It stops problems for a while, but the core issue remains. No endgame.

3) Endgame - Expos
This is an option that will require a lot of work from ET. Creating a whole system or storyline using the expo server or the outlands server. An endgame filled with RP Expos. This way, main can remain as the more passive or slower paced / slow burn RP hub (as well as for planning), whilst the expo server is the place for killing.
Great solution. Unfortunately requires a number of GMs to be VERY dedicated.


4) Endgame - Main
This is an interesting option. But basically it's 'lighting the fuse' on the server. Letting it blow up as we approach the end of V2. Turning the resistance from more of an underground movement to something bigger, and having an all out territory war on the server. This COULD be interesting, but it could also increase the divide between 'the two playerbases' (sad that I even have to say that) even more.


5) An official rebel faction
I genuinely think this would help RP. The LFC was a botched attempt (unfortunately) at this. But a quality control system, even a whitelist (with perhaps IC ways of getting in?) would be really good, and a great way to enforce order into an otherwise lawless 'faction'. Unfortunately, I got too much push back and so didn't really push for this.

One last thought:
I really think we should stop blaming either side. Both sides have had their issues, but also both sides have many well respected people in the community. It's kind of human nature to want to stick to 'tribes' and blame 'the other'. But that's genuinely not useful. This is a systematic issue and a systematic solution needs to happen. Ideally, we should experiment with it now, so V3 can have it be ready on day one.
